Alex Chiang wrote:
> Commit 3800345f723fd130d50434d4717b99d4a9f383c8 introduces the
> pciehp_slot_with_bus module parameter, which was intended to help
> work around broken firmware that assigns the same name to multiple
> slots.
>
> Commit 9e4f2e8d4ddb04ad16a3828cd9a369a5a5287009 tells the user to
> use the above parameter in the event of a name collision.
>
> This approach is sub-optimal because it requires too much work from
> the user.
>
> Instead, let's rename the slot on behalf of the user. If firmware
> assigns the name N to multiple slots, then:
>
> The first registered slot is assigned N
> The second registered slot is assigned N-1
> The third registered slot is assigned N-2
> The Mth registered slot becomes N-M
>
> In the event we overflow the slot->name parameter, we report an
> error to the user.
>
> Signed-off-by: Alex Chiang <achiang@hp.com>
> ---
> dr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p.h | 1 -
> dr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_core.c | 21 ++++++++++++++-------
> dr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_hpc.c | 11 +----------
> 3 files changed, 15 insertions(+), 18 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p.h b/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p.h
> index e3a1e7e..9e6cec6 100644
> --- a/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p.h
> +++ b/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p.h
> @@ -43,7 +43,6 @@ extern int pciehp_poll_mode;
> extern int pciehp_poll_time;
> extern int pciehp_debug;
> extern int pciehp_force;
> -extern int pciehp_slot_with_bus;
> extern struct workqueue_struct *pciehp_wq;
>
> #define dbg(format, arg...) \
> diff --git a/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_core.c b/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_core.c
> index 3677495..4fd5355 100644
> --- a/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_core.c
> +++ b/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_core.c
> @@ -41,7 +41,6 @@ int pciehp_debug;
> int pciehp_poll_mode;
> int pciehp_poll_time;
> int pciehp_force;
> -int pciehp_slot_with_bus;
> struct workqueue_struct *pciehp_wq;
>
> #define DRIVER_VERSION "0.4"
> @@ -56,12 +55,10 @@ module_param(pciehp_debug, bool, 0644);
> module_param(pciehp_poll_mode, bool, 0644);
> module_param(pciehp_poll_time, int, 0644);
> module_param(pciehp_force, bool, 0644);
> -module_param(pciehp_slot_with_bus, bool, 0644);
> MODULE_PARM_DESC(pciehp_debug, "Debugging mode enabled or not");
> MODULE_PARM_DESC(pciehp_poll_mode, "Using polling mechanism for hot-plug events or not");
> MODULE_PARM_DESC(pciehp_poll_time, "Polling mechanism frequency, in seconds");
> MODULE_PARM_DESC(pciehp_force, "Force pciehp, even if _OSC and OSHP are missing");
> -MODULE_PARM_DESC(pciehp_slot_with_bus, "Use bus number in the slot name");
>
> #define PCIE_MODULE_NAME "pciehp"
>
> @@ -194,6 +191,7 @@ static int init_slots(struct controller *ctrl)
> struct slot *slot;
> struct hotplug_slot *hotplug_slot;
> struct hotplug_slot_info *info;
> + int len, dup = 1;
> int retval = -ENOMEM;
>
> list_for_each_entry(slot, &ctrl->slot_list, slot_list) {
> @@ -220,15 +218,24 @@ static int init_slots(struct controller *ctrl)
> dbg("Registering bus=%x dev=%x hp_slot=%x sun=%x "
> "slot_device_offset=%x\n", slot->bus, slot->device,
> slot->hp_slot, slot->number, ctrl->slot_device_offset);
> +duplicate_name:
> retval = pci_hp_register(hotplug_slot,
> ctrl->pci_dev->subordinate,
> slot->device);
> if (retval) {
> + /*
> + * If slot N already exists, we'll try to create
> + * slot N-1, N-2 ... N-M, until we overflow.
> + */
> + if (retval == -EEXIST) {
> + len = snprintf(slot->name, SLOT_NAME_SIZE,
> + "%d-%d", slot->number, dup++);
> + if (len < SLOT_NAME_SIZE)
> + goto duplicate_name;
> + else
> + err("duplicate slot name overflow\n");
> + }
> err("pci_hp_register failed with error %d\n", retval);
> - if (retval == -EEXIST)
> - err("Failed to register slot because of name "
> - "collision. Try \'pciehp_slot_with_bus\' "
> - "module option.\n");
> goto error_info;
> }
> /* create additional sysfs entries */
> diff --git a/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_hpc.c b/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_hpc.c
> index ad27e9e..ab31f5b 100644
> --- a/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_hpc.c
> +++ b/drivers/pci/hotplug/pciehp_hpc.c
> @@ -1030,15 +1030,6 @@ static void pcie_shutdown_notification(struct controller *ctrl)
> pciehp_free_irq(ctrl);
> }
>
> -static void make_slot_name(struct slot *slot)
> -{
> - if (pciehp_slot_with_bus)
> - snprintf(slot->name, SLOT_NAME_SIZE, "%04d_%04d",
> - slot->bus, slot->number);
> - else
> - snprintf(slot->name, SLOT_NAME_SIZE, "%d", slot->number);
> -}
> -
> static int pcie_init_slot(struct controller *ctrl)
> {
> struct slot *slot;
> @@ -1053,7 +1044,7 @@ static int pcie_init_slot(struct controller *ctrl)
> slot->device = ctrl->slot_device_offset + slot->hp_slot;
> slot->hpc_ops = ctrl->hpc_ops;
> slot->number = ctrl->first_slot;
> - make_slot_name(slot);
> + snprintf(slot->name, SLOT_NAME_SIZE, "%d", slot->number);
> mutex_init(&slot->lock);
> INIT_DELAYED_WORK(&slot->work, pciehp_queue_pushbutton_work);
> list_add(&slot->slot_list, &ctrl->slot_list);
